Summary of Duties:
The service technician is responsible for performing a wide range of HVAC activities for commercial and residential customers. Customer based activities require an individual possessing trait such as decisiveness, initiative, tact, judgement, integrity, dependability, and the ability to communicate in a technically credible manner. Daily job stress will run from minimal to extreme based on varying factors such as weather, site consideration, time constraints, sales potential, travel requirements, and customer needs.
Duties Include:
· Assisting the operations manager in the planning, organizing, motivating, controlling of human and other resources in support of departmental jobs, assignments, sales and goals.
· Leading by example through ad hoc installation teams displaying timely, efficient and profitable completion of assigned jobs and tasks.
· Performing special or complicated installation activities without assistance, including performing periodic on-call duties as required.
· Training employees on installation related subjects and procedures.
· Conducting quality control inspections of installation jobs, monitoring the technical progress of newly assigned department employees.
· Conducting point of work sales of IAQ services, unit compressors, unit replacements, add-on’s service contracts, and developing lead referrals from the sales staff.
· Ordering all job materials and coordinating with the project managers for the timely delivery of same.
· Turn-key on-site management of all projects assigned to them including all facets of work, even those not being directly performed by them.
· Coordination with other trades on the projects without assistance to resolve minor problems, conflicts, etc.
· Performing related duties as directed by the operations manager.
